In dire circumstances, the prime focus should be the victim's safety and well-being. If medical help is required:
If injuries appear intentional, inform the individual to preserve any evidence for potential legal actions. Guidance from your manager is vital in deciding subsequent steps, including involving the police or initiating a safeguarding investigation if a crime is suspected.
